Strengthened Security Procedures

A significant advantage of utilizing an E-Sign API is the improved security it delivers for digital transactions. Such APIs integrate advanced encryption protocols, ensuring that sensitive information is safeguarded during the signing process. Furthermore, they often offer robust authentication methods, such as multi-factor authentication and biometric verification, which serve to validate the identity of signers. This minimizes the risk of fraud and unauthorized access, fostering greater trust in digital agreements. Furthermore, E-Sign APIs keep a detailed audit trail, documenting every action taken during the signing process, which can be vital for compliance and legal purposes. Overall, advanced security measures not only protect businesses but also build confidence among clients and partners, ensuring digital transactions remain trustworthy and efficient.

How to Simply Integrate E-Sign APIs

Integrating E-Sign APIs can streamline document signing processes for businesses, improving productivity and minimizing processing times. To get started, businesses should assess their unique requirements and select an API that matches their goals. Well-known choices include DocuSign, Adobe Sign, and HelloSign, each providing unique capabilities.

Additionally, programmers can take advantage of the API's documentation, which typically includes sample code and implementation guides. By utilizing RESTful web APIs, businesses can easily connect their current platforms, such as document management platforms or CRMs. Adopting secure authentication methods, like OAuth-based authentication, guarantees that data stays secure during transactions.

Evaluating review this content the setup in a test environment enables organizations to identify and resolve problems before going live. Finally, training staff on the new system can boost system utilization and streamline operations. By following these steps, businesses can successfully implement E-Sign APIs and greatly enhance their digital signing operations.

Enhancing Compliance and Security Using E-Signature APIs?

Not true. Implementing E-Sign APIs greatly strengthens security and compliance for businesses. Such APIs employ sophisticated encryption methods to secure sensitive information during transfer, ensuring that documents remain confidential and tamper-proof. Through the use of advanced authentication techniques, like layered authentication, companies can validate the identities of document signers, reducing the risk of fraud.

Furthermore, E-Sign APIs commonly include audit logs that document every step taken on a document. This functionality is vital for conformance with legal requirements like the Electronic Signatures in Global and National Commerce Act and the Uniform Electronic Transactions Act (UETA). Businesses can demonstrate adherence to compliance frameworks, guaranteeing that executed documents remain legally acknowledged and binding.

In a rapidly evolving digital environment, focusing on security and compliance via E-Sign APIs not only protects sensitive data but also builds trust with clients and partners. This forward-thinking strategy is essential for sustaining a reputable business.

Rising Trends in E-Sign Technology for 2026

As businesses continue to emphasize security and regulatory adherence via E-Sign APIs, the landscape of electronic signatures is evolving rapidly. In 2026, several emerging trends are shaping this technology. Artificial intelligence is progressively embedded within e-sign systems, enhancing user experience by automating tasks such as automated document validation and tailored user engagements. Moreover, distributed copyright technology is steadily gaining momentum, delivering permanent transaction logs and strengthening the reliability of digital signatures.

One other notable trend is the rise of mobile-centric technologies, permitting users to complete document signing smoothly on different devices. This change accommodates a growing remote workforce, streamlining processes across different platforms. Additionally, enhanced biometric authentication methods are being adopted, additionally strengthening overall security. As the demand for efficient, secure signing solutions grows, businesses must adapt to these trends to remain competitive and ensure adherence in an evolving regulatory landscape.
